Ingredients for Baked Hot Dogs in Tortilla Dough

Here’s everything you’ll need to make this ridiculously easy snack (measurements matter – no winging it here!):

  • 4 hot dogs – standard sized, pre-cooked (my favorite brand is Hebrew National)
  • 4 large flour tortillas – 8-inch diameter works best
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ese – packed tight in the measuring cup
  • 1 egg – beaten for that golden crust
  • 1 tbsp melted butter – plus more if you’re feeling indulgent
  • 1/2 tsp each garlic powder & dried oregano – the flavor powerhouse combo

Ingredient Notes & Substitutions

Okay, let’s talk swaps – because life happens and we don’t always have the exact ingredients:

Hot dogs: Turkey or chicken hot dogs work great (just check they’re pre-cooked). For vegetarians, those plant-based “hot dogs” actually bake surprisingly well in this!

Tortillas: Whole wheat adds nice texture, and gluten-free ones work if you crisp them longer (watch closely). Corn tortillas? Too stiff – they’ll crack when rolling. For more on tortilla types, check out this guide to tortillas.

Cheese: Vegan shreds melt fine, but for best gooeyness, I mix half vegan cheddar with a slice of dairy American. Pro tip: Freezing cheese 10 minutes makes shredding easier!

How to Make Baked Hot Dogs in Tortilla Dough

Alright, let’s get these beauties in the oven! The key here is working quickly so your tortillas don’t dry out. Don’t stress if your first roll isn’t perfect – mine still come out a little wonky sometimes and they always taste amazing!

Step 1: Prep and Assemble

First, lay out your tortillas and sprinkle cheese down the center – but leave about an inch clean at the ends (this prevents oozing out the sides). Place a hot dog on each cheesy line, then roll tightly like a burrito, tucking in the ends as you go. Pro tip: If your tortillas crack, microwave them for 10 seconds wrapped in a damp paper towel – they’ll become pliable again!

Step 2: Bake to Perfection

Pop your rolled hot dogs seam-side down on the baking sheet and brush generously with beaten egg – this gives that gorgeous golden crust! Bake at 375°F for 12-15 minutes until they’re crisp and slightly puffed. While still hot, brush with the garlic-herb butter (trust me, this is the step that makes everyone ask “what’s your secret?”). Let them cool just enough so you don’t burn your tongue – about 2 minutes – then dig in!

Tips for the Best Baked Hot Dogs in Tortilla Dough

After making these dozens of times (and learning from my mistakes!), here are my foolproof tricks:

  • Seal the deal: Press the seam firmly – if it won’t stick, dab a tiny bit of egg wash as “glue” before baking.
  • Cheese control: Too much cheese makes a mess – keep it to about 2 tablespoons per hot dog max.
  • Fresh is best: These lose crispness fast, so serve within 30 minutes of baking (but honestly, they never last that long!).
  • Crisp hack: For extra crunch, flip them halfway through baking – just be gentle!

Storage and Reheating

Okay, let’s be real—these baked hot dogs rarely last long enough to store! But if you miraculously have leftovers (or made extra), here’s how to keep them tasty. Wrap cooled hot dogs tightly in foil and refrigerate for up to 2 days. To reheat, skip the microwave unless you like soggy tortillas—instead, pop them in a 350°F oven or air fryer for 5-7 minutes until crispy again. FAQs About Baked Hot Dogs in Tortilla Dough

Can I freeze these baked hot dog wraps? Absolutely! Freeze them before baking – wrap tightly in plastic then foil. When ready, bake frozen adding 5 extra minutes. They won’t be quite as crisp but still totally delicious.

Will corn tortillas work instead of flour? I’ve tried it – they tend to crack when rolling. If you must use corn, warm them first and roll gently, but flour tortillas really are best for that perfect pliable wrap.

Can I prep these ahead? You bet! Assemble up to 4 hours before baking – just keep them covered in the fridge. The egg wash goes on right before they hit the oven though, or tortillas get soggy.

What dipping sauces do you recommend? Ohhh my favorites are honey mustard, sriracha mayo, or even warmed marinara for a pizza dog vibe! Get creative – the kids love ranch mixed with hot sauce.

Are these good cold? Honestly? Not really. That magical crispy texture disappears when chilled. If you must pack them for lunch, wrap separately and reheat briefly to revive the crunch!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 hot dogs
  • 4 flour tortillas
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
  • 1 tbsp melted butter
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 tsp dried oregano

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Place a hot dog on each tortilla and sprinkle with cheese.
  3. Roll the tortilla tightly around the hot dog.
  4. Brush the wrapped hot dogs with beaten egg.
  5. Place on a baking sheet and bake for 12-15 minutes until golden.
  6. Mix melted butter, garlic powder, and oregano. Brush over baked hot dogs before serving.

Notes

  • Use pre-cooked hot dogs for best results.
  • Substitute with whole wheat tortillas for a healthier option.
  • Add mustard or ketchup inside before rolling for extra flavor.
